We think the answer is "ORCA" which means:
- noun
- • Predatory black-and-white toothed whale with large dorsal fin; common in cold seas
An example sentence would be:
- • "The orca is commonly referred to as the killer whale."
- • "We were lucky enough to spot an orca during our boat tour."
